Output 66c2a9120727d44f06794d99efcc0a9859ab7b56b91a4deeb6f5a35430885bca:22

value
153557
script pubkey
OP_0 OP_PUSHBYTES_20 2bc6de709b103ef5804b5f5d4a100fa8988462f4
address
bc1q90rduuymzql0tqzttaw55yq04zvggch5lkfpl8
transaction
66c2a9120727d44f06794d99efcc0a9859ab7b56b91a4deeb6f5a35430885bca